Validator Operational Standards

Algorithm

Validator operational standards fundamentally rely on deterministic algorithms to ensure consistent and predictable network behavior, particularly crucial for consensus mechanisms and state transitions within blockchain architectures. These algorithms govern the processes by which validators propose, verify, and finalize transactions, directly impacting network security and throughput. Precise algorithmic specification minimizes ambiguity and potential for manipulation, fostering trust among network participants and enabling reliable derivative contract execution. The selection and implementation of these algorithms are subject to rigorous audit and formal verification to mitigate systemic risk and maintain network integrity, especially when handling complex financial instruments. Continuous refinement of these algorithms is essential to adapt to evolving threat landscapes and optimize performance characteristics.
